Name
Octavius acutipenis Janák, 2014: 200, figs. 10–13
- Type locality: South Africa, KwaZulu-Natal Province, Ongoye Forest, 28°50'S, 31°44'E.
- Holotype: DNMNH , ♂, 4.–5.xii.2010, E-Y 3890, leg. Ruth Müller.
- Etymology: This species is named after the acute median lobe of the aedeagus (acuti + penis = having acute aedeagus).
